It gets worse/stranger...
The Chief Policy advisor to No10 (aka Director of the Number 10 Policy Unit) is one Munira Mizra an ex member of the Revolutionary Communist Party (a trotskyist outfit that disbanded in 1997) she wrote for their magazine - Living Marxism and its successor website - Spiked. Many of her colleagues became highly influential in the eurosceptic circles of the Tory Party.
She worked for the Royal Society of Arts, the The Tate, then became development director for Policy Exchange (a Tory think tank), in 2008 she started working for BoJo firstly as Cultural Advisor, then as Director of Arts, Culture & Creative Industries, then as Deputy Mayor for Education & Culture and then when BoJo became PM she was appointed to her current role.
She has been a cheerleader for Brexit, has publicly stated that racism is exaggerated by people in politics, has argued against there being institutionalised racism in the judicial and penal system, is opposed to multicuturalism & defended BoJos letterbox comments. The ex RCP members of her network have wormed their way into the Conservative Party and have given a veneer of intellectualism to climate denial, aided AIDS denialism in Africa, been funded by and acted as PR agents for agrochem businesses (Monsanto in particular), developed an ideology to justify cuts to arts funding, regularly apologised and excused the worst excesses of Serb nationalism, supported and excused the behaviour of the EDL and so the list goes on.
The really worrying thing is she and her pals have the ears of not only the PM, but Gove and the rest of the staunchly hard-Brexit leading lights in the Tory party. Alongside Cummings, it is no wonder we are rapidly drifting up shit creek without a paddle to our name.
